Wheel Locks/ Lugnut Size

Anyone know if the lugnut size is something standard??

I would like to put on some wheel locks but $30 for the infiniti ones seems a little steep. I wonder if aftermarket ones would fit without any problem.

Re: Wheel Locks/ Lugnut Size

OK kids, I got it. The Size is 12mm x 1.25 and I got a nice set of em with the key (addional keys CAN be ordered) at my local auto parts place for under $10 bucks. Put em on myself with the spare tire wrench. Much better than $30 for the ones from the dealer.
